edhec bm vs emlyon mim

How is edhec mim in business mgmt track when compared to emlyon mim? Which one would be the better option? I have heard edhec is good only for finance? Is it true? Which one is better?

2 Comments
 

I would say across all specializations edhec is better, and has been improving a lot over the last few years.

Sure, finance is top notch at edhec but bm is good too.

Source: worked as an mim admissions consultant part time for 2 years, when I was at school (neither of the two mentioned above)
